    3. Setting Ruthie lived in a small town. She went to a small school and knew all of the students in the fourth grade. Ruthie loved to talk and had many friends. Since Ruthie had a lot of friends she was involved in a lot of activities. No matter where Ruthie went in town, everyone knew her and her family.

    4. Setting In the middle of the school year, Ruthie’s family moved to the big city. Her new school was huge. There were too many children in fourth grade for Ruthie to meet them all. Ruthie felt uncomfortable talking to new people. A lot of the students and teachers thought Ruthie was shy. It was hard for Ruthie to make new friends. She was not involved in activities after school. She was miserable in the big city.

    9. Adventures in Writing Rifka writes letters to her cousin Tovah. Her letters are like diary entries, in which she expresses what happens, how she feels, and what she thinks during her journey. This week, you will get to write a diary entry just like Rifka.
